The Valley Vikings's recent rough patch got a bit rougher on Thursday after their third straight loss. They were dealt a 62-17 loss at the hands of Amador. That's two games in a row now that Valley has lost by exactly 45 points.
Valley's loss came despite strong showings from Jordyn Gibson and Annaliese Hernandez. Gibson scored eight points, while Hernandez scored six points. Hernandez scored a full 35.3% of Valley's points, the fourth time in a row she's earned more than a third of the team's points.
Valley has traveled a rocky road recently, as they've lost five of their last six matches, which put a noticeable dent in their 2-7 record this season. As for Amador, the win got them back to even at 6-6.
Valley is on the road again on Friday and play against Golden Sierra at 5:30 a.m. on December 15th. Golden Sierra is coming into the match on a four-game losing streak. Amador won't have much time to rest: their next game is against Union Mine at 7:00 p.m. on December 15th. Union Mine will be looking to extend their current three-game winning streak.
